Pre-requisites: Passing Score on the Compass/CMAT Test or by Placement; ENG 091 or ESL 091 3 credits, 3 hours This course is designed for Allied Health majors and will aid them in applying mathematical concepts to job situations. The course will include: an integrated review of arithmetic and algebraic skills required for the Allied Health Professions, mathematical topics pertaining to Pharmacology and Radiology, conversion using metric, household and apothecary systems of measurement, preparation of oral-medication, solutions, medical dosage, variations and introduction to linear, exponential and logarithmic functions, understanding graphs, charts and application problems.
